Human but the first 2 lines are not needed, are they. The root cause of the arerr 552 ora00936 sql server 156 errors is erroneous execution of woi. The problem occurs when the sas table is empty, and there are no keys to add in the where clause. We will notify you when the new public build of dotconnect for oracle is available for download. The ora00936 message is a missing expression error in oracle. However, when i try to add a layer i get could not add the specified data object to the map. The first example is the product of missing information in a select statement, which triggers the vast majority of ora00936 errors. Visit sap support portals sap notes and kba search. The sql statement ends with an inappropriate clause. You cannot use the select statement in the sql expression formulas. But i did not find anything that matches with my problem. Jan 08, 2015 the date field in where clause of the sql query which is generated in discoverer plus will be created with wrong syntax. If you have more than one oracle install, it might be. You can also catch regular content via connors blog and chriss blog.
Jan 21, 2020 the script syntax is nearly identical the guide except that oracle. Oracle suggests to apply patch to resolve this issue. On executing the program i am getting an error ora 00936. Ora00936missing expression error in oracle discoverer. This error can occur if the procedural option is not installed and a sql. Sql expressiions are similar to formulas where you can define some the sql fucntions. The oracle oerr utility notes this about the ora00936 error. Could not execute statement on remote server mylinkedserver. Hi all, i have written plsql and the sniplet of it is below. It can also occur if an sql statement with a where clause includes an invalid relational operator. That entire missing expression means is that when attempting to operate a. You tried to execute a sql statement but you omitted a part of the syntax. Correct the syntax by removing the inappropriate clauses. Click more to access the full version on sap one support launchpad login required.
I have a object that selects distinct values of col1. If you have more than one oracle install, it might be looking at the wrong one. And of course, keep up to date with asktom via the official twitter account. Problem with running syntactically correct statement and code. A required part of a clause or expression has been omitted. Order by cannot be used to create an ordered view or to insert in a certain order. The first example is the product of missing information in a select statement, which triggers the vast majority of ora 00936 errors. Learn the cause and how to resolve the ora00936 error message in oracle. Official oracle documentation states that the cause is due to a search condition that was entered with an invalid or missing relational operator. Hi all, when i ran the procedure below, i am running into the following error. Then these sql expression formulas can then be referred in the selection formulas the advantage being the record selection is pushed to the server for definite. The bug with using parentheses in binary expressions in ef core is fixed. Stack overflow for teams is a private, secure spot for you and your coworkers to find and share information.
Use the older c style comments instead of the ones. Or if video is more your thing, check out connors latest video and chriss latest video from their youtube channels. Check the statement syntax and specify the missing component. If you just enter select on line one, and then from abc. What is missing or expressions in the selected columns are incomplete. Database administrators stack exchange is a question and answer site for database professionals who wish to improve their database skills and learn from others in the community. This occurs when entering select on the first line, but then failing to reference the list of columns following the select. Learn troubleshooting ora00936 missing expression in oracle sql.
Check the sql statement expression and correct with proper expression. Fix oracle error ora00936 missing expression tutorial. Work order slm data source workflow with update of slm. Dec 04, 2015 the root cause of the arerr 552 ora 00936 sql server 156 errors is erroneous execution of woi. When trying to use the sql below, i keep getting the ora. Learn the cause and how to resolve the ora 00936 error message in oracle. This comment has been how to prove that a paper published with a the prompt to mandatory. From the sql query above, you can see that the table name is not resolved in. I tried to use the sql statement directly like follows. Listed below are two ora00936 missing expression ora06512 the latter half of a sql statement. Check that you have all the keywords that are required update, set check there are no extra commas where there shouldnt be. The date field in where clause of the sql query which is generated in discoverer plus will be created with wrong syntax. Handleerrorhelperint32 errcode, oracleconnection conn, intptr opserrctx, oposqlvalctx poposqlvalctx, object src, string procedure, boolean.
Free source code and tutorials for software developers and architects updated. For example, a select statement may have been entered without a list of columns or expressions or with an incomplete expression. Check the arguments for the functions mentioned in the expression. Quick tips to resolve the ora00936 missing expression. Connor and chris dont just spend all day on asktom. Either a host language program call specified an invalid cursor or the value. Error 42000 microsoftodbc driver for oracleoracleora. The oracle oerr utility notes this about the ora 00936 error.
1172 149 284 826 1481 131 900 1288 1017 1216 481 779 349 14 651 699 825 1284 1099 999 1224 1285 787 197 945 222 1128 1023 1434 630 1503 1290 516 677 1463 39 782 345 1053 490 1225 1395 660